KCNQ1
-
Official Full Name
Potassium Voltage-Gated Channel, KQT-Like Subfamily, Member 1
-
Overview
The human KCNQ1 gene encodes the pore-forming subunit of Kv7.1, a voltage-gated potassium channel (also known as KvLQT1). Mutations in KCNQ1 cause an inherited form of long QT syndrome, type 1. KCNQ1 channels expressed in the heart are anti-targets in cardiac risk assessment. -
